Elevate Your Space: A Guide to Choosing Wall Art
Want to inject style into your living spaces? Look no further than wall art! It's a dynamic tool to express yourself, create focal points, and transform the feel of any room. But with so many options available, choosing the perfect piece can be overwhelming. Don't worry! This guide will walk you through the process, helping you discover wall art that truly speaks to you.
- Take into account your existing decor: What colors, textures, and styles are already present in the room? Choose art that complements these elements.
- Establish your personal style: Do you gravitate toward classic pieces, or something more unique? Let your taste be your guide.
- Don't be afraid: Try alternative combinations of art to create a truly one-of-a-kind look.
Decorative Masterpieces: Matching Art to Your Space
Elevate your home decor with the ultimate blend of artwork. Finding a suitable piece for each room can revitalize the atmosphere.
Think about your personal style and that particular area's function. A vibrant piece might be ideal for a large living area, while a muted artwork could complement a cozy bedroom.
- Discover diverse artistic styles like abstract, landscape, or portraiture.
- Consider the hues that compliment your existing decor.
- Display your artwork thoughtfully to maximize its impact.
